Turkish rebar prices increase amid costlier scrap
Turkish rebar producers, which decreased export prices last week, have raised them again this week on costlier scrap, Kallanish reports.
With Turkish mills buying scrap again after a two-week break, scrap prices have increased. Facing higher costs, mills increased rebar quotes to $445-450/tonne fob actual weight from $440-445/t fob last week.
